The Role of Public Betting Trends in Shaping Odds Movements

Public betting trends play a significant role in shaping the movement of odds in various betting markets, including sports betting, horse racing, and other gambling activities. Understanding how these trends influence odds can help both bettors and bookmakers make more informed decisions.

Public betting trends refer to the collective betting behavior of the general public. These trends are often reflected in the volume and distribution of bets placed on different outcomes. For example, if a large number of bettors are placing wagers on a particular team or horse, this creates a trend that can influence the odds set by bookmakers.

Bookmakers monitor public betting patterns closely. When a significant portion of bets favors one outcome, bookmakers may adjust the odds to balance their exposure and reduce risk. This process is known as line movement. For instance, if many bettors are backing the favorite team, the bookmaker might lower the odds for that team and increase the payout for the underdog to encourage bets on the less popular outcome.

Factors Influencing Odds Movement

  • Large betting volume on one side
  • Sharp betting from professional bettors
  • Injury reports or team news
  • Public perception and media influence

Implications for Bettors

Understanding public betting trends can provide valuable insights. When odds move significantly due to public betting, it may indicate that the market has already priced in certain information, making it less profitable to bet against the trend. Conversely, sharp odds movements driven by professional bettors can signal value opportunities for savvy bettors.
